CRUSADER, noun. Person engaged in a crusade.
Dictionary definition
CRUSADER, noun. A disputant who advocates reform.
CRUSADER, noun. A warrior who engages in a holy war; "the Crusaders tried to recapture the Holy Land from the Muslims".
